Wildlanders.com is proud to present the first FREE online database and birding diary service for keeping your trip and birding lists and notes. Each sighting is recorded by genus, species, common name, trip name, location, habitat, vertical canopy, and areas for notes and comments. The record can be marked 'public' or 'private' (ie, endangered species).

Soon to Come: Trip leaders from environmental organizations or teachers at Universities can create Master Lists with more than one participant all sharing their data. Each member maintains a private list but selects the same "Trip Name" as the leader. The sightings and data can then be viewed by each individual as a personal listing and is also included in the Master List. The power here of course is that trips and lists can be shared with other enthusiasts at your discretion through temporary access passwords and the ultimate knowledge base made available to professionals performing research.

Sorting and searching features will be provided to help you navigate and organize the data in the database.
